A Quantity Surveyor (QS) manages all construction project finances and contractual relationships. To ensure projects remain within budget while delivering financial value by estimating costs, drafting bills of quantities (BOQ), handling tenders, and valuing completed work for subcontractor payments. A Quantity Surveyor's responsibilities break down into two main phases Pre-Contract Work (Before Construction)
- Cost Estimation & Planning: Calculating the required quantities of materials, labor, and time based on design drawings.
- Tendering & Procurement: Preparing tender packages, analyzing bids from contractors, and procuring materials at the best value.
- Drafting Contracts: Helping write the contracts and formulating the Bill of Quantities (BOQ).
Post-Contract Work (During & After Construction)
- Cost Control & Monitoring: Tracking real-time expenses against the initial budget to prevent overruns.
- Valuations of Work: Inspecting the construction site to certify the value of work completed so contractors and subcontractors can be paid.
- Variation & Claims Management: Calculating the cost implications of design changes (variations) and handling contractual claims or disputes.
- Final Accounts: Settling all final financial records and accounts upon project completion.
